    AnnotationThe conference reflected on various aspects of modern productions of Ancient Greek and Roman Drama based on the research activities of the individual participants. The issues treated in the papers were discussed in 4 panels: 1) Modes of Performing Classical Drama Around Europe and Beyond: focusing on Ancient Greek and Roman Drama on modern stage and the -isms (Classicism, Romantism, Realism, Naturalism, Symbolism, Expressionism etc.). 2) Theorizing Discourse: Bridging and Exploiting the Gaps – discussing present issues as well as history of the interpretation of Ancient Drama and Theater (research and ideas/ideologies). 3) Staging Classical Drama After 2000. 4) War, Peace, and Politics: Enacting the Distressed Self & Other – presenting papers on Classical Drama on stage in the time of oppression.
